What are Line items?
The Line items module is the simplest way to receive pricing requests from suppliers. The module provides Suppliers with individual data fields to be filled in for each item in the request. Buyers are then presented with an easy to manage data set which can be viewed on the platform or downloaded as a .CSV file.
How do you add Line items to a request?
1. Login and open the relevant request. Got to the Details tab. Select + Add section, choose Line items from the drop down menu.
2. Enter Title for the Line items section, and if it is a multi-stage request, choose the Stage that the section will become visible to the Supplier.
3. Under BUYER- ADDED LINE ITEMS, click + Add line items, enter a Description, the Unit and Quantity of each line item you add.
4. After entering your line items, choose the currency you'd like the prices to be submitted.
5. If it is a sealed bid, you can choose to lock (or seal) this section, and set criteria for it to be unlocked; Bid deadline passes and/or Team member unlocks.
6. Under SUPPLIER-ADDED DOCUMENTS choose whether or not to allow your Suppliers to submit additional line items as part of their bid by switching the toggle betwen YES/NO.
7. Click the Save button (see below) to save your work and to be able to add additional sections to the Page you are working on.
How do you view Line items sections once the request is live?
- Log in, and open the relevant Live request. Select the Line items tab.
- As Suppliers send their intention to bid, their name will appear in the Line items table. The table automatically collates Supplier responses across all bids.
- If a Line items section has been locked, the fields will show 'Locked' until a bid is unlocked according to the criteria specified by the Request owner.
- When rates have not been entered, fields are marked as 'Incomplete'. Supplier's overall status for Line items fields is shown at the top of the table (either 'Complete' or 'Incomplete')
- To download a summary view, select 'Download report' in the top right hand corner of the section. All data provided in the table will be included in the report and can be imported into a spreadsheet.
Things to remember
- You can add as many Line items sections as you wish to a request.
- You can add additional Line items to a request once it is live by issueing a revision.
- You can edit the different permission settings to access the Line items section under the Teams tab.
- Suppliers can enter their rates at any time before the deadline. They will not need to do this all in one go, and their work will be saved as they update their rates.
- All Supplier updates or changes to their rates will be logged in the Audit trail.
